Pumpkin Cream Cheese Dip with Grahams Recipe

This Pumpkin Cream Cheese Dip with Grahams is a festive, no-bake treat that’s perfect for Halloween parties, Thanksgiving gatherings, or cozy fall nights. Pumpkin puree is blended with cream cheese, powdered sugar, and pumpkin pie spice to create a smooth, creamy dip. Paired with crunchy graham crackers, apples, or pretzels, it’s an irresistible seasonal snack that kids and adults both love. Quick to make and full of pumpkin spice flavor, this dip is a must-have for your autumn spread.

Ingredients
  

  • 8 oz cream cheese softened
  • 1 cup pumpkin puree
  • ½ cup powdered sugar
  • ¼ cup brown sugar
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• 1 tsp pumpkin pie spice
  • ½ tsp cinnamon
  • Graham crackers for serving

Method
 

  1. In a large bowl, beat cream cheese until smooth.
  2. Add pumpkin puree, powdered sugar, brown sugar, vanilla, and spices. Beat until creamy.
  3. Transfer to a serving bowl.
  4. Chill for at least 30 minutes before serving for best flavor.
  5. Serve with graham crackers, apple slices, or pretzels.

Notes

  • Top with crushed graham crackers for garnish.
  • Add a dollop of whipped cream for extra creaminess.
  • Keeps in fridge up to 3 days.
